General Summary:
Field-based Field Reimbursement Manager (Kidney Patient Support Program, KPSP) serving as a local subject matter expert to nephrology practices, providing non-promotional access and reimbursement education; supporting timely patient access to prescribed Vertex kidney therapies via troubleshooting and territory-level payer expertise.
Key Duties And Responsibilities:
- Establish compliant connections with nephrology office personnel (care team and administrative staff for prior authorizations/patient access).
- Partner with case management to address escalated access issues; coordinate handoffs using CRM triggers/workflows.
- Educate offices on copay, PAP, Bridge programs, and affordability pathways; provide follow-up on case status and insurance documentation requirements.
- Maintain understanding of commercial and government prescription insurance requirements and payer trends.
- Deliver on-site/virtual in-services and training on payer policies/formulary updates; PA/medical exception criteria; coding/billing (ICD-10, CPT) and documentation; distribution pathways, hub services, enrollment, and reimbursement workflows.
- Independently manage a multistate region; prioritize accounts based on patient need, payer dynamics, and KPSP demand.
- Adapt office engagement to existing workflows; develop territory engagement plans to minimize access barriers.
- Adhere to non-promotional guidelines; comply with legal/compliance/privacy guardrails.
- Maintain confidentiality of patient health information; apply program business rules and work instructions.
